B. To wear chest strap
a. Wet the conductive pads on
the rear of the chest belt with
a few drops of water, Saliva or
conductive gel to ensure solid
contact.
8
b. Strap the heart rate chest belt across your chest.
To ensure an accurate heart rate signal, adjust the
strap until the belt fits snugly below your (chest)
pectoral muscles.
c. Attach the transmitter to the strap, marked ‘L’
towards left.
9
WARNING Inaccurate heart rate data will be
detected if the device is worn in wrong directions.

WARNING
a.Cleaning of transmitter and strap in a washing
machine or dryer is strongly prohibited.
b.Before hand washing the device, detach the
transmitter of Heart Rate Monitor where
electrodes are located, This part is not
washable.
c.While washing the straps, make sure water is
no higher than 30℃.
d.Ironing, bleaching or heating is prohibited.
11
BATTERIES
The transmitter use CR2032 3V battery. The battery
already installed. The battery typically last one year .
A. Using a coin, twist the battery door counter
clockwise until it clicks out of place.
12
B. Remove the old battery and insert the new battery
with the +side upwards.
C. Replace the battery door by twisting it clockwise
until it is firmly in place.
IMPORTANT
1. Non-rechargeable and rechargeable batteries must
be disposed of properly. For this purpose, special
containers are provided for battery disposal at
communal collection centers.
13
2. Batteries are extremely dangerous when swallowed!
Therefore, keep batteries and small articles away from
children.
3. The batteries supplied must not be recharged,
reactivated by any other means, dismantled, put into
fire or short-circuited.
